GONADORELIN 5mg
Gonadorelin is a synthetic form of Gonadotropin-Releasing Hormone (GnRH), a naturally occurring hormone produced by the hypothalamus in the brain. Its main role is to regulate the reproductive hormone system by signaling the pituitary gland to release LH (Luteinizing Hormone) and FSH (Follicle-Stimulating Hormone).
How Gonadorelin Works
Gonadorelin stimulates the hypothalamic–pituitary–gonadal (HPG) axis:
- Hypothalamus releases GnRH (Gonadorelin)
- Pituitary releases LH and FSH
- LH & FSH signal the testes or ovaries to produce sex hormones.

Difference From HCG
- Gonadorelin stimulates the body to produce LH naturally
- HCG acts like LH directly.
